Always do cdex conversion for OatWriter dexlayout

Don't use DexLayout without CompactDex conversion in the case where
a profile is passed in.

Bug: 77498934
Test: test-art-host

(cherry picked from commit ddf39558dd3f5f889e9cdfa54807499574098db7)

Merged-In: I6c0498db71f1324402b8dfe2ab3ef9bbd121b4cc
Change-Id: I91145cb2ffd3c1acf93d3fc45c404d3a8e6cefd5
2 files changed